Bullied For Being Different, This 10-Year-Old Girl Walked On Stage And Left The Entire World Speechless

No one expected what was about to happen when a shy 10-year-old girl stepped onto the stage.

At first glance, Roberta Battaglia looked like any other young child with a big dream. Standing under the bright lights, surrounded by thousands of eyes watching her every move, she appeared nervous and overwhelmed. But the moment she opened her mouth, everything changed.

The young singer from Toronto delivered a jaw-dropping performance that instantly stunned the audience. Her powerful rendition of the hit song “Shallow” sounded so mature, emotional, and technically flawless that many people could hardly believe the voice was coming from a 10-year-old child.

Within seconds, the room fell silent.

The judges stared in disbelief. The audience watched with tears in their eyes. Every note carried incredible emotion, confidence, and passion far beyond her years. It wasn’t just a performance—it was a moment that nobody would forget.

But what made Roberta’s appearance even more powerful was the story behind her voice.

Before stepping onto the stage, she bravely shared her experience with bullying. Like many children, she had faced hurtful comments and criticism from others. Instead of allowing those painful moments to define her, she chose to turn her pain into motivation.

Her courage touched millions of viewers around the world.

While some people tried to bring her down, Roberta refused to give up on her dream. She continued practicing, believing in herself, and working toward the moment that could change her life forever.
